The Story of the World Vol. 1: Ancient Times, Revised Edition Audiobook
This spirited reading of Susan Wise Bauer’s The Story of the World Vol. 1: Ancient Times, Revised Ed. brings to life the stories and records of the peoples of Ancient Times, covering the major historical events from the beginning of civilization to the fall of the Roman Empire.
The Story of the World Audiobook is a collaboration between Jim Weiss, whose voice is “liquid gold” (CNN TV), and Susan Wise Bauer, whose writing has been described as “timeless and intelligent” (Publishers Weekly).
Enjoy this Audiobook independently, along with The Story of the World Vol. 1: Ancient Times, Revised Ed. Text (sold separately), or as a supplement to a traditional history curriculum.

Question
Is it easy to navigate by chapter with the MP3s? In other words, can I go directly to “chapter 11” or will I have to fast forward and rewind through the audio to get what I want?
(0) (0) Watch Unwatch
WTM Press Minion
Yes! Each chapter (and in some cases, each half-chapter) is its own MP3 file, so you can click directly on that. You don’t have to fast-forward through hours of audio to find what you need.

E Els
Question
Would this work on an iphone? or a chromebook?
(0) (0) Watch Unwatch
WTM Press Minion
Yes! Any device that can download a ZIP file and can play MP3s will work. Both the iPhone and the chromebook would work. But since iphones don’t utilize ZIP files…for the iphone, you’d want to download the files onto a laptop or desktop first, put them in iTunes, and then “synch” them with the iPhone.
